2nd investment in same area or branch out?

Alex Pirila
Posted

Greetings all:

Back story: My wife and I bought and rehabbed a home in Tempe, AZ with a VA Loan in early 2019. In late 2019, I was offered a great job in Chicago. We now rent our Tempe house and use a local property manager.

Question: When we are ready to purchase another investment, should we stick to the Phoenix Metro area or venture into other markets?

Primers:

1. While I love my job, it does keep me quiet busy.

2. I was born, raised and lived in all parts of the Phoenix Metro area.

3. However, I understand I have a natural bias toward Phoenix because it’s home.

Any guidance or insight would be tremendously appreciated.
